Hi guys,
I have twin mercruiser 350 Mag horizon (ow360139) engines with 1 bad Map sensor. The mercruiser part (885165 or updated part 8M0087834) seems to go for about $350. A mechanic at my yard says they sell the automotive version for like $30. I found the auto version of the sensor which looks physically identical but it comes as multiple versions rated at different kPa to volts.

Calibration Data:

P1 -> 50 kPa at 0.40V
P2 -> 400 kPa at 4.65V

Anyone know where to find the kPa to volt specs for the mercruiser part? I checked the manual (31) and it doesnt seem to have it.

Not sure either one of those will work exactly for your MAPT. MAP requires a 3 Bar or 300 kpa (3 atmospheres). The numbers to look for are

Merc 885165
Bosh 0261230075
GM 12568929

Since you have a naturally aspirated (NA) motor, you need a 1 Bar sensor. Only motors that need 3 Bar are ones with turbo or super chargers. 1 Bar - 1 atmosphere
